Washington Post Publishes Editorial From Mother Of Dead Bullied Gay Child
In response to widespread criticism for publishing an anti-gay editorial from Family Research Council head Tony Perkins, the Washington Post has posted a response from the mother of 11 year-old Carl Walker-Hoover, who took his life last year after relentless homophobic bullying. It was one year ago that 11 year-old Carl Walker-Hoover hung himself in his bedroom closet after being relentlessly tormented by anti-gay bullies at his school. The mother of Carl Walker-Hoover, who took his own life at the age of 11 due to anti-gay bullying, testified before the House Education and Labor Committee yesterday in support of anti-bullying laws.
